What is an associate designer?

An associate designer is responsible for assisting the lead designer or art director with the production and design of creative projects. Associate designers can work in a variety of industries, include fashion, graphic design, and interior design. As an associate designer, your job duties vary significantly by industry, but they generally involve researching trends, communicating with clients, and procuring materials necessary for designing the project. Regarding academic qualifications, you need a bachelor’s degree in fine arts or a major related to the specific industry in which you choose to work. Some employers may require previous experience or a portfolio that proves your design skills.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an associate designer?

To thrive as an Associate Designer, you generally need a strong foundation in design principles, proficiency with design software (such as Adobe Creative Suite), and a relevant degree or portfolio showcasing your work. Familiarity with tools like Photoshop, Illustrator, InDesign, and sometimes prototyping platforms like Figma or Sketch is often required. Strong attention to detail, creativity, and effective communication skills help you excel in collaborative environments and respond to feedback. These skills ensure you can contribute high-quality, innovative designs that meet client or project objectives in a fast-paced industry.

How does an associate designer typically collaborate with other team members during a project?

Associate Designers work closely with senior designers, project managers, and cross-functional teams such as marketing, engineering, or product development. Collaboration often involves participating in brainstorming sessions, contributing design ideas, and iterating on feedback from multiple stakeholders. Regular communication—via meetings, design reviews, and digital collaboration tools—is essential to ensure that design concepts align with project goals and brand guidelines. This teamwork helps Associate Designers learn from experienced colleagues and refine their skills in a supportive environment.

What is the difference between Associate Designer vs Junior Designer?

AspectAssociate DesignerJunior Designer
Required CredentialsBachelor's degree in design or related field; some employers may prefer internship experienceBachelor's degree in design or related field; entry-level position
Work EnvironmentCollaborates with senior designers, participates in projects, and supports design teamsAssists in design tasks, learns workflows, and gains practical experience
Employer & Industry UsageUsed across creative agencies, in-house design teams, and studiosCommon entry-level role in similar settings

Associate Designers typically have more responsibilities and may oversee parts of projects, while Junior Designers focus on learning and supporting design tasks. Both roles require similar educational backgrounds, but Associate Designers are often more experienced and involved in project execution.

Our Project Designer - Land Development will work in alignment with the supervision of a licensed Professional Engineer to support final delivery of key client deliverables for large commercial developments. The primary focus of this position will involve providing day to day support on site layout, grading, and full construction site coordination/design. 
  • Prepare accurate presentation, design, and construction documents using AutoCAD.
  • Collaborate and coordinate with the project team, including engineers, architects, designers, consultants, and clients.
  • Interpret relevant codes, regulations, and client requirements to guide the design process.
  • Implement and utilize established CAD standards, templates, and best practices to ensure consistency and quality.
  • Calculate quantities, areas, and other essential data necessary for land development civil engineering designs.
  • Travel periodically to perform site investigations, take measurements, and observe construction progress, followed by the preparation of detailed reports and exhibits.
  • Assist in compiling construction plans from all disciplines and ensure timely submission to agencies with jurisdiction.
  • Focuses on developing detailed technical drawings and designs, calculating material quantities, and collaborating with interdisciplinary teams.  
  • Works closely with engineers, architects, and project managers to ensure that all designs meet project specifications, industry standards, and safety regulations.
  • Perform other duties as assigned.
